Tara Harlow Death – Tara Janine Harlow, a resident of Beavercreek, Ohio, and an alumna of Wright State University passed away on April 23, 2023. She was 43 years old at the time of her death. Who was Tara Harlow?
Tara Janine Harlow was born on April 11, 1980, in Xenia, Ohio, to her beloved parents Larry and Sandy Simison. She was the middle child of Larry and Sandy Simison. Tara was married to the love of her life, Chad Harlow, in 2004 and had two beautiful and beloved children, Keegan and Kenna.
Tara grew up in Xenia, Ohio, and settled with her family in Beavercreek, Ohio. Tara was a devoted wife and mother who loved watching her children play sports. Tara was a graduate of Wright State University. After marriage, she worked as a full-time stay-at-home mom. She cared more about people and their well-being than anyone else. Tara Harlow’s obituary and funeral arrangements
Public visitation is to be held at Newcomer Funeral Home (3380 Dayton Xenia Rd) on Monday, May 1, 2023, from 9:30 am until the time of the funeral service at 11:30 am. Tara will be laid to rest next to her husband at Silvercreek Cemetery in Jamestown (the cemetery is located on the east side of Ohio State Route 72 about 0.3 miles north of its intersection with Ross Road).
